20090174524 | USER-ASSISTED PROGRAMMABLE APPLIANCE CONTROL - A universal remote control interacts with a user to assist in training to one or more appliances. If the appliance is activated by a rolling code activation signal, a sequence of different rolling code activation signals is transmitted until the user indicates a successful transmission. If the appliance is activated by a fixed code activation signal, a fixed code word is used to generate and transmit each of a sequence of different fixed code activation signals until the user indicates a successful transmission. At least one of the sequences of activation signals inserts a preset amount of time after each activation signal transmission. If user input is not received within the preset amount of time, the next activation signal in the sequence is transmitted. | 07-09-2009 |
20100279612 | Method of Pairing a Portable Device with a Communications Module of a Vehicular, Hands-Free Telephone System - A method of pairing Bluetooth™ enabled devices including a portable phone with a Bluetooth™ communications module of a vehicular, hands-free telephone system includes using vocal communications to prompt an operator of the phone to enter a given PIN number into the phone. The presence of any Bluetooth™ enabled devices within the vicinity of the communications module is searched. Vocal communications are used to prompt the operator to vocally state a name for the phone and to vocally state a pairing priority to be assigned to the phone. If the assigned pairing priority is not assigned to another Bluetooth™ enabled device, then the name and the pairing priority are associated with the phone. Communications between the communications module and the phone are then enabled if the phone has the highest pairing priority amongst all of the Bluetooth™ enabled devices present within the vicinity of the communications module. | 11-04-2010 |

20080254746 | VOICE-ENABLED HANDS-FREE TELEPHONE SYSTEM FOR AUDIBLY ANNOUNCING VEHICLE COMPONENT INFORMATION TO VEHICLE USERS IN RESPONSE TO SPOKEN REQUESTS FROM THE USERS - A voice-enabled, hands-free telephone system includes an appliance, speakers, and a component connected to a communications bus of a vehicle. The component provides to the bus a signal indicative of a condition monitored by the component. During a call between a user using a Bluetooth enabled phone and another party the appliance wirelessly communicates voice signals from the user to the phone for transmission to the party and the appliance wirelessly receives voice signals of the party from the phone and outputs these signals to the speakers via the bus for the user to hear. In response to the user speaking a request for the status of the condition, the appliance obtains the component signal from the bus to determine the status of the condition and audibly announces a computerized voice signal indicative of the status of the condition through the speakers via the bus for the user to hear. | 10-16-2008 |
20080316006 | Method and System for Communicating Vehicle Diagnostic Data to Internet Server Via Bluetooth Enabled Cell Phone for Subsequent Retrieval - A method and system for communicating vehicle diagnostic data to a vehicle service provider employs sensors for generating sensor signals indicative of the status or condition of vehicle components. A diagnostics module in the vehicle generates diagnostic data based on the sensor signals and transfers the diagnostic data to a communications module of a hands-free phone system in the vehicle. The communications module wirelessly communicates the diagnostic data to a Bluetooth enabled cell phone in the vehicle using Bluetooth communications. The cell phone communicates the diagnostic data to an Internet server via the Internet. The provider accesses the diagnostic data from the Internet server using a computer connected to the Internet to determine if any of the vehicle components are in need of repair or maintenance. The provider notifies a user of the vehicle of any vehicle component that is in need of repair or maintenance. | 12-25-2008 |

20090283747 | METALLIZED SILICON SUBSTRATE FOR INDIUM GALLIUM NITRIDE LIGHT EMITTING DIODE - A light emitting diode having a metallized silicon substrate including a silicon base, a buffer layer disposed on the silicon base, a metal layer disposed on the buffer layer, and light emitting layers disposed on the metal layer. The buffer layer can be AlN, and the metal layer ZrN. The light emitting layers can include GaN and InGaN. The metallized silicon substrate can also include an oxidation prevention layer disposed on the metal layer. The oxidation prevention layer can be AlN. The light emitting diode can be formed using an organometallic vapor phase epitaxy process. The intermediate ZrN/AlN layers enable epitaxial growth of GaN on silicon substrates using conventional organometallic vapor phase epitaxy. The ZrN layer provides an integral back reflector, ohmic contact to n-GaN. The AlN layer provides a reaction barrier, thermally conductive interface layer, and electrical isolation layer. | 11-19-2009 |

20100110698 | Universal Housing for Recessed Lighting - A light housing for recessed installation in a ceiling plenum has a top, an apertured bottom, and side walls between the top and bottom. Housing support brackets may be attached at three alternate locations on the side walls for hanging the housing between joists in a ceiling plenum, such that the housing can be hung in any of three different orientations to fit available space in the ceiling plenum. A lamp socket in the housing is tiltable about two different axes through a first angular adjustment between a downlight position and a wallwash position and tiltable through a second angular adjustment between a downlight position and an adjusted position, such that a directional light source installed in the lamp socket may be aimed for downlight, wallwash or adjustable illumination after installation of the housing in a ceiling. | 05-06-2010 |
